mysql InnoDB的事务隔离级别与hibernate的使用
mysql InnoDB支持四类事务隔离级别,同时还支持一致性读操作,也就是单独的select语句不受事务影响,不会对数据库记录加锁,除非是在serializable级别,该语句会默认转为select ... lock in share mode; 在这种模式下会对数据库表加意向共享锁,同时对单独的记录加共享锁。

在mysql中只有两种select语句加锁,select ... lock in share mode;和select ... for update;第一个是对表加意向共享锁,对记录索引加共享锁,第二类是对表加意向排他锁,对记录索引加排他锁。

转自
lunzi   2010-12-17 00:20:08 评论:1   阅读:573   引用:0

发表评论>>

署名发表(评论可管理,不必输入下面的姓名)

姓名:

主题:

内容: 最少15个,最长1000个字符

验证码: (如不清楚,请刷新)

Copyright@2004-2010 powered by YuLog